The Power of “The Voice”

The Bene Gesserit’s primary advantage comes from their signature ability: “The Voice.” In a game where combat is often decided by a split-second decision, The Voice gives the Bene Gesserit unparalleled control over the battlefield. This ability allows a player to compel an enemy to stand still, drop their weapons, or even move to a specific location. In a one-on-one PvP encounter, this is a game-changing ability that can turn the tide of a fight in an instant. A player who is about to be outmatched can use The Voice to stun their opponent, giving them a chance to escape, heal, or deliver a killing blow. In group fights, The Voice becomes an invaluable crowd-control tool, allowing a Bene Gesserit player to take a key enemy out of the fight and create an opening for their allies. While other classes have powerful combat abilities, none have the psychological control that The Voice provides.

Furthermore, the Bene Gesserit’s skill tree is designed to enhance this psychological dominance. Their “Compel” ability, a core skill in their arsenal, not only stuns an enemy but also forces them to move towards the Bene Gesserit’s position, setting them up for a perfect attack. This ability, combined with their strong defense and evasion, makes them a nightmare to fight against. While the Swordmaster may excel in pure melee damage, and the Mentat in ranged combat, the Bene Gesserit wins battles before they even begin. This is a class that rewards cunning, patience, and a deep understanding of your opponent’s weaknesses. In a game with a high-stakes PvP system, this mental edge is an unparalleled advantage.

A Master of Mobility and Survivability

Beyond their psychological abilities, the Bene Gesserit are also a force to be reckoned with due to their superior mobility and survivability. Their “Bindu Sprint” ability, a movement skill that allows them to run at incredible speeds, is a game-changer for exploration and escaping dangerous situations. On a planet as vast and hostile as Arrakis, where the ever-present threat of a sandworm looms, the ability to cross open sands quickly and efficiently is invaluable. This mobility is a major reason why many veteran players recommend starting with the Bene Gesserit class, as it makes the early game far more manageable. When paired with the Trooper’s “Shigawire Claw,” the Bene Gesserit can become a mobile, hard-to-catch force that can outmaneuver any opponent.

The Bene Gesserit also have a number of skills that are designed for survival. They can unlock abilities that increase their health pool, provide resistance to heat and poison, and improve their ability to evade attacks. This combination of powerful mind-control abilities, high mobility, and exceptional survivability makes them a true jack-of-all-trades. They are a class that can not only dominate in a one-on-one fight but can also excel at exploration, resource gathering, and team support. This versatility is what makes them a top-tier choice for both solo players and those who prefer to play in a group. While other classes may specialize in a single aspect of the game, the Bene Gesserit are masters of all.
